Subcontracting
Subcontracting is a particular form of service provision or cooperation in production between two enterprises. More specifically, it refers to the service provided by a subcontractor to a buying firm or a principal for the production of pieces, components, or subassemblies that are to be incorporated into a product that the principal will sell.
Depending on the disciplinary perspective taken, emphasis is placed on the nature of the economic relationship, the existence of a formal or informal contract, or the relationship of trust or subordination between the buying firm or principal and the subcontractor.
